Some strategies to prepare compulsory papers of CSS.
Dear Members of the forum,
I am sharing some strategies to prepare compulsory papers of CSS. These guidelines have been compiled in the light of my personal experience and guidance of many senior members of the forum and other CSPs. Senior members of the forum are requested to give their valuable feedback so that other young aspirants of CSS may take advantage of our fruitful discussion. English Précis & Composition: • Introduction: This paper can be divided into following sections: Précis - 25 marks Comprehension - 20 marks Expansion - 20 marks Vocabulary & Grammar (Synonyms, Antonyms, Idioms, Phrasal Verbs, Homonyms, Change of Narration, Correction of Sentences, Active Voice & Passive Voice etc) - 35 marks • Books: i. Exploring the World of English by Saadat Ali Shah ii. English Précis by Joya & Jappa (caravan Publishers) iii. Brush Up Your English by ST Imam ( Chap 13 & 14) • Strategy for preparation: i. Give due time to this paper. ii. Solve past papers. iii. Practice to make précis of paragraphs and get checked by expert of English language. iv. Time management is very essential for this paper. v. Practice is Key to success. • How to attempt paper: i. Time management is very important in this paper. Précis consumes much time around one hour, so try to save time from other questions. Solve précis question on last rough page and then final draft on main page(s). Give suitable title to the paragraph. ii. Grammar & Vocabulary Section is mathematical and it can earn maximum marks. Vocabulary MCQs should be solved by formulas: a) Surety formula, b) exclusion formula, c) logical guess of answers. iii. Always keep your nerves in your control and try to do your best in the paper. English Essay: • Introduction: Essay paper is considered the toughest paper. This first paper decides your eligibility to succeed in the examination. Writing practice can make your task easy. In essay paper one needs to discuss specific issue which was asked to be address. • Books: Although there is no need to prepare specific book for this paper but you may get an idea of English essay from one or more books. You may go through the following books: i. Top 30 English Essays ii. Current/Contemporary Essays iii. Any other good book(s) • Strategy for preparation: i. Prepare your own notes of English essay ii. Practice to make outline(s) of the essays. That’s very important technique to produce best English essay. iii. Support your essay with arguments/quotes/statistics etc. (Read editorials of a good English newspaper to develop your analytical skills.) iv. Practice is Key to Success. • How to attempt paper: i. In examination Hall, read all topics of English Essays very carefully and choose the one which you have prepared very well. Make outline on the last rough page and also write introduction on the rough page. After making best outline, re-write it on the front page and then Introduction afterwards. Try to do your best in the paper. Give your conclusion at the end of the essay. The conclusion should summarize the whole debate and do not introduce new ideas in conclusion. After writing complete essay, read it for possible errors/omissions and correct them accordingly. ii. Some other important tips for essay are: a) There should be relevancy and coherence in the essay. b) Quality matters not quantity so don’t worry about number of words. c) Only focus on that aspect of essay which is asked to discuss, so don’t beat about the bush. d) Don’t try to attempt an essay on controversial topic. Everyday Science: • Books: i. Everyday Science by Dr. Akram Kashmiri ii. Encyclopedic Manual of Everyday Science by Dr. Rab Nawaz Samo iii. Any other good book (s) • Strategies for preparation: i. It is very scoring subject comprises of 50% Objective/MCQs and 50% Subjective. Reasonable time is required to prepare this subject and pays you a lot. ii. MCQs should be solved by formulas: a) Surety formula, b) exclusion formula, c) logical guess of answers iii. Solve all available past papers. iv. Practice making diagrams. Diagrams can help in getting good marks in this paper. Pakistan Affairs: • Books: i. Pakistan Affairs by Ikram Rabbani (Caravan Publishers) ii. Top 20 questions of Pakistan Affairs (Jahangir Publishers) iii. Any other good book. • Strategies for preparation with reference to important topics: i. Pakistan Affairs paper can be divided into two major portions i.e. Pre-Partition and Post-Partition periods. In pre-partition period following questions should be prepared in best manner: a. Evolution/Establishment of Muslim society in Sub-Continent/India b. Sheikh Ahmad Sirhindi (Mujadid Alf Sani R.A) and his movement/role c. Shaha Wali Ullah and his movement d. Sir Syed Ahmad Khan and Aligarh Movement (Every aspect) e. Khilafat Movement/Faraizi Movement f. Comparison among Aligarh, Deoband & Nadwatul Ulema Educational Movements g. Two Nation Theory/Ideology of Pakistan Post-Partition period may prepared with reference to contemporary affairs of Pakistan which will help you in Current Affairs paper. Following are the important topics for post partition period: a. Lahore Resolution b. Objective Resolution c. Nehru Report vs. Fourteen Points d. Lucknow Pact and Hindu Muslim Unity e. Constitution of Pakistan/Constitutional Crisis in Pakistan f. Contemporary Issues: Kashmir issue, Balochistan Issue, Water Issues/Crisis, Corruption, Unemployment, Increasing Population, Terrorism & Insurgency, Militancy & Extremism, Educational Problems, Economic Issues, Energy Crisis etc. g. Foreign Policy of Pakistan h. Geo-political and geostrategic importance/significance of Pakistan i. Other contemporary/current affairs of Pakistan • How to attempt paper: a. One may attempt two questions from above mentioned portion and the remaining two questions may be attempted from Post-Partition period or Current/Contemporary Affairs of Pakistan. b. The questions may be attempted with headings and sub-headings. c. Give Critical Analysis and Conclusion (wherever possible). Current Affairs: • Introduction: Current Affair paper can be generally divided into following segments: a. Domestic/National Affairs: Good governance, Democracy in Pakistan, Political & Administrative Issues/matters, Militancy & Extremism, Unemployment, Illiteracy and Lack of Education, Economic Issues, Energy Crisis, Water Crisis/Issues, Corruption, Increasing Population, Poverty etc. Different Scandals, Ethnic & Sectarian violence, Lack of National integration, Role of Media (Conventional & Social), Pakistan Protection Ordinance 2013 and current domestics issues/matters b. International Affairs: Foreign Policy of Pakistan, Pakistan’s relations with China, India, Afghanistan, Iran, USA, Central Asian Countries and the Muslim World, US-India relations & implications for Pakistan, US-China relations, India-China relations & implications for Pakistan, India-Afghanistan relations & implications for Pakistan, Withdrawal of NATO forces & implications for Pakistan, IP gas pipeline, Geo-political and geostrategic significance of Pakistan, c. International Issues: Kashmir issue, Palestine issue, Muslim Ummah’s issues, Global Warming/Climate Change, d. Organizations: UNO & its organs (every aspect), OIC, SAARC, ASEAN, SCO, EU etc • Books/Magazines/Digests/Newspapers: i. Jahangir World Time Magazine ii. Contemporary Affairs by Imtiaz Shahid iii. Dawn or any other English Newspaper • Strategies for preparation: i. Read the articles/columns on above mentioned issues and develop your own opinion based on arguments & critical analysis. ii. Practice is Key to success. • How to attempt paper: i. Attempt the questions which you have prepared very well. ii. Give suitable headings/sub-headings wherever possible. iii. Give critical analysis and conclusion. iv. Time management is very important so take care of time while attempting long questions. Islamiat: • Books: i. Islamiat by Hafeeza Bano Butt (Caravan Publishers) ii. Top 20 questions (Jahangir Publishers) iii. Islami Nazria-e-Hayat by Khursheed Ahmad • Strategies for preparation: i. This paper can be divided into two major segments. First segment deals with pure Islamic matters/teachings (Quran, Revelation,Toheed, Akhirat, Prayer, Zakat,Hajj, Fasting, Jihad, Ijtehad, Ijma etc) and second segment deals with contemporary affairs with respect to Islamic perspective. ii. Prepare segment one with respect to Verses and Hadiths. iii. Prepare segment two with respect to Islamic interpretation of contemporary issues. • How to attempt paper: i. Quote Verses and Hadiths wherever possible. ii. Make headings and sub-headings. iii. Positive approach should be adopted in second segment. iv. Give argumentative analysis of contemporary affairs in the light of Islamic principles. |
